Abstract

Let q≥3 be an integer, χ denote a Dirichlet character modulo q, for any real number a≥ 0, we define the generalized Dirichlet L-functions L(s,χ,a)=∑n=1(χ(n))/((n+a)s), where s=σ+it with σ>1 and t both real. It can be extended to all s by analytic continuation. For any integer m, the famous Gauss sum G(m,χ) is defined as follows: G(m,χ)=∑a=1qχ(a)e((am)/(q)), where e(y)=e2πiy. The main purpose of this paper is to use the analytic method to study the mean value properties of the generalized Dirichlet L-functions with the weight of the Gauss Sums, and obtain a sharp asymptotic formula.
